Challenges

Multiple carriers means multiple blind spots

  • Booking status lives on a different portal for every carrier

    Shippers running multiple BCO and NVO relationships have no single place to see booking status, allocation, or performance. Every carrier tells its own version of the story.

  • Contract allocation goes unused, or over-committed

    Without real-time visibility into MQC utilization, teams underuse contracted rates and pay for expensive spot or FAK bookings instead, or overcommit and scramble to cover the gap.

  • Carrier QBRs run on their data, not yours

    Walking into a carrier review with no independent acceptance-rate or on-time data means the conversation happens on the carrier's terms, not yours.

FAQs

Frequently asked questions

Do I have to move my carrier contracts to Flexport to use Booking Management?

No. Booking Management is available standalone. You keep your direct BCO carrier contracts and NVO relationships; Flexport acts as your booking agent and gives you one platform to see and manage all of it.

How is this different from a shipment tracking tool?

Tracking tools show you what happened. Flexport actively manages the booking process: escalating rejections, executing your routing guide, and rebooking when space is denied, then showing you the data.

How do you track allocation utilization against my contracts?

The Allocation Management Dashboard shows real-time MQC utilization by carrier and lane, so you can see what's committed, used, pending, and remaining instead of waiting on a weekly spreadsheet from each carrier.

What carrier performance data will I actually get?

Acceptance and rejection rates, booking response times, SO release speed, and ETD-to-ATD variance by carrier and lane, objective data you can bring straight into your next carrier QBR.

Will my suppliers need to learn a new system?

All your suppliers book through the Flexport platform using booking templates, replacing carrier portals and email chains. Our implementation team leads supplier onboarding and training.

Can this work alongside my existing ERP or TMS?

Yes. Milestone data pushes to your ERP and PO updates flow back in through standard integration. Booking Management complements your existing systems rather than replacing them.
